We’ve lost countless hours of sleep thanks to video games, it’s only fair they paid us back. With the Xronos Clock, some arcade action will help you get up on time. If you’re wondering why an alarm clock would cost over a cool two hundo, there are a few reasons. First, it looks freaking awesome. Second, it’s open source and customizable so you can change how it functions. It sports 10 alarm tones (stored on a microSD so you can actually change them up), a changeable color display, and can even tell you the temperature in your room. The Xronos Clock is made by hand and obviously very limited in quantity. Of course, we love it because we can do some button smashing while we hit snooze 10 times in a row.
